Handover note — Lexiscan string extractor. The script scans the Varnholt UI repo for translatable strings and writes them to a signed manifest consumed by the Tollbright localization pipeline. Note for review: it runs with read-only repo credentials, and the manifest signing key lives in the Corvette vault, rotated quarterly. No network egress beyond the artifact store. Escaping of interpolated placeholders was hardened last sprint. The person responsible for ongoing maintenance is named below.

account owner for tawef-yadug: Jorius Normir Silath

## Summary

This PR adds backpressure to the Hollin notification fan-out path. Previously, a burst from one tenant could saturate the dispatch pool and delay everyone's pushes. We now bound the per-tenant queue, shed oldest-first when the bound is hit, and apply a global concurrency ceiling with adaptive backoff. I've load-tested against replayed traffic from the March spike and latency stayed flat. Please review rollout order carefully since these knobs interact. The chosen constants are listed below.

tuning table, yajog-yahof:
BUDGETS = {
    "lamvan": 303,
    "wenox": 460,
    "fenvan": 525,
}

Meeting notes — Fernhollow infra sync (excerpt)

Flaky DNS resolution in the staging cluster again; intermittent NXDOMAIN on internal service lookups, roughly 2% of queries. Suspected cause: resolver cache eviction under load. Mitigation in place: retry wrapper on the Larkspool gateway. Release manager asked that the next cut be blocked until root cause is confirmed. Fix targeted for end of week. Investigation owner is named below.

named custodian: Oliath Ralax